Differences at a glance

The iPhone 16 Pro (2024) and the iPhone 17 Pro Max (2025) represent two advanced generations of high-end smartphones designed to handle demanding workflows and daily communication needs. While the iPhone 16 Pro focuses on a balanced, compact form factor, the iPhone 17 Pro Max expands screen space and refines internal capabilities. Both models operate on modern software ecosystems, but they cater to slightly different hardware preferences and physical handling styles.

Screen quality

Visual immersion and panel characteristics provide distinct viewing environments depending on whether you prefer a compact display or an expansive multimedia canvas.

  • Display technology: Both models utilize advanced OLED panel technology with high contrast ratios, deep black levels, and vibrant color reproduction for daily viewing.
  • Refresh rate and fluidity: Smooth scrolling and responsive touch interaction are standard on both screens via adaptive high refresh rate capabilities.
  • Size and outdoor visibility: The iPhone 16 Pro provides a compact 6.3-inch viewing area suitable for single-handed navigation, while the iPhone 17 Pro Max offers a larger 6.9-inch display with high peak brightness levels for clear outdoor readability.

Miscellaneous

Physical handling, connectivity standards, and daily utility elements shape how each device fits into travel routines and active lifestyles.

  • Connectivity standards: Both models support modern fifth-generation cellular networks, fast Wi-Fi protocols, and reliable Bluetooth pairing for wireless accessories.
  • Physical dimensions: The iPhone 16 Pro measures 149.6 by 71.5 by 8.25 millimeters and weighs 199 grams, whereas the larger iPhone 17 Pro Max measures 163.4 by 78 by 8.8 millimeters and weighs 233 grams, resulting in a heavier, more substantial feel in the hand.
  • Authentication and ports: Universal USB-C charging ports and secure facial recognition sensors are integrated into both designs for streamlined daily use.
